UWEZO means ‘Ability’ in Swahili! This is is the ultimate value we possess as an organization and the potential that need to be unleashed among children and young people with disabilities.
We collaborate with partners to safeguard children and youth with disabilities, ensuring they are protected from harmful practices and that inclusive safeguarding measures are established. We empower these youth to become agents of change through active participation in mentorship, civic engagement, and self-advocacy. Additionally, we work with parents and guardians to play a vital role in nurturing children with disabilities for a hopeful future, ensuring their rights are protected according to Rwandan law and international human rights treaties. Despite the challenges they face, we believe in their potential as future leaders and citizens.

How we move from evidence to impact for children and young people with disabilities.
We listen to children, caregivers, and communities to identify root causes of exclusion and risk.
We provide inclusive education, mentoring, and livelihood pathways that build confidence and skills.
We work with schools, government, and duty bearers to strengthen policies and safeguards.
We cultivate youth advocates, parent networks, and partnerships so gains endure over time.
